Roux-en-Y gastric bypass is a well-established metabolic and bariatric procedure that can help patients lose weight and improve many obesity-related health conditions. The operation creates a small stomach pouch and connects it to a lower portion of the small intestine, so food bypasses most of the stomach and the first part of the small intestine.
During Roux-en-Y gastric bypass, the surgeon creates a small stomach pouch and connects it directly to the small intestine. Food then travels through the pouch into the intestine, bypassing most of the stomach and the upper portion of the small intestine. Digestive juices continue to mix with food farther downstream.
A small stomach pouch limits the amount of food that can be eaten at one time.
Food bypasses most of the stomach and the first part of the small intestine.
Changes in gut hormones, appetite and metabolism contribute to weight loss and metabolic improvement.
Gastric bypass may be appropriate for selected patients who need substantial and durable weight loss, especially when obesity is associated with metabolic disease or significant reflux. The decision should always be individualized.
For selected patients with obesity and significant GERD, Roux-en-Y gastric bypass is often considered because it can improve reflux symptoms. This may be particularly important when choosing between gastric bypass and sleeve gastrectomy. The best operation depends on the patient’s anatomy, symptoms, medical history and overall goals.
Gastric bypass may be performed using laparoscopic or robotic-assisted minimally invasive techniques. During robotic-assisted surgery, the surgeon remains completely in control of the operation. The robotic platform provides high-definition visualization and highly maneuverable instruments that may be useful for precise reconstruction, complex anatomy and selected revisional procedures.

Gastric bypass is a powerful treatment, but long-term success requires a plan. Patients need lifelong attention to nutrition, adequate protein and hydration, recommended vitamin and mineral supplementation, regular physical activity, and periodic laboratory monitoring.
Because the procedure changes the way food and nutrients travel through the digestive system, long-term follow-up is particularly important.
Some patients experience symptoms known as dumping syndrome after gastric bypass, especially after foods high in sugar or certain refined carbohydrates. Symptoms may include abdominal discomfort, nausea, diarrhea, flushing, lightheadedness or a rapid heartbeat. Nutrition counseling and food choices can help reduce these symptoms.
Weight regain can occur after any bariatric procedure and should be evaluated without judgment. Possible contributors include nutrition patterns, medications, medical conditions, anatomy and metabolic adaptation. Treatment may include nutrition support, obesity medicine, anti-obesity medication, endoscopic therapy or revisional surgery depending on the cause.
As with any major operation, gastric bypass has potential risks. These can include bleeding, infection, blood clots, leak from a surgical connection, bowel obstruction, ulcers, internal hernia, narrowing at a connection, gallstones, nutritional deficiencies and the possible need for additional procedures. Because nutrient absorption is altered, lifelong vitamin and mineral supplementation and follow-up are essential.
Reversal is technically possible in selected situations but is complex; gastric bypass is generally intended as a permanent operation.
